Gauging The Financial Well-being
To genuinely understand a monetary condition , it's essential to separate amongst assets and liabilities . Assets are properties one own that represent value – think property , shares, or cash. Conversely, liabilities are a remaining debts – like loans , personal balances, or student loans. Essentially, your net worth is calculated by subtracting your total obligations from your total holdings; a positive number indicates financial strength, while a negative number suggests you may need to re-evaluate your financial strategies .

Smart Investing: Growing Your Money Long-Term
To foster substantial assets over years, adopt a strategic financial approach. Don't chasing fast returns, as these often carry excessive danger . Instead, concentrate on diversifying your resources across a assortment of stocks , bonds , and possibly land. Periodic investments , even in small sums , accumulated over the decades can produce remarkable outcomes . Remember to adjust your holdings periodically to maintain your desired asset allocation and stay aligned with your objectives .
